About Strawberry Park Hot Springs
Nestled in a mountain valley surrounded by aspens, Strawberry Park features natural stone pools fed by geothermal springs. The clothing-optional policy after dark adds to its laid-back Colorado vibe. One of the most beloved hot springs in the Rockies.

Frequently Asked Questions
- What is the water temperature at Strawberry Park Hot Springs?
- The water temperature at Strawberry Park Hot Springs is 104°F.
- How much does Strawberry Park Hot Springs cost?
- Strawberry Park Hot Springs costs $15-$20 per person.
- Is Strawberry Park Hot Springs clothing optional?
- Yes, Strawberry Park Hot Springs is clothing optional.
- What minerals are in the water at Strawberry Park Hot Springs?
- The water at Strawberry Park Hot Springs contains Sulfur, Iron, Calcium.
- How difficult is it to get to Strawberry Park Hot Springs?
- Strawberry Park Hot Springs has a easy difficulty level with short walk access.
